Understanding RTP: More Than a Number
RTP is a statistical measure indicating the percentage of wagered money that a slot machine is designed to pay back over the long term. For example, a slot with an RTP of 96.31% is expected, over many spins, to return €96.31 for every €100 wagered. While RTP alone does not guarantee specific outcomes in the short term, it offers vital insight into the game’s fairness and potential profitability.
